The University of Colorado ski team continued its strong season by winning the three-day Denver Invitational in Aspen with 879 points.

Runner-up Utah trailed CU by 10 points and the University of Denver placed third in the eight-team field. Wyoming finished last.

In the women’s 21K freestyle Sunday, CU placed second (junior Eliska Hajkova), third (sophomore Joanne Reid) and fourth (senior Alexa Turzian). Utah’s Maria Graefnings won the event.

DU sophomore Andrew Dougherty finished fourth in the men’s 21K freestyle. Utah’s Miles Havlick won the event.

CU, ranked No. 2 nationally behind Vermont, has won three of its four meets this winter.
